Re: Is Bitcoin transaction fee fixed?
by
Swapzone_pr
on 15/11/2021, 07:35:09 UTC
No but very less than compared to what banks are charging us nowadays.Transaction fees are included with your bitcoin transaction in order to have your transaction processed by a miner and confirmed by the Bitcoin network. The space available for transactions in a block is currently artificially limited to 1 MB in the Bitcoin network. This means that to get your transaction processed quickly you will have to outbid other users. More the fees,more quickly your transaction will be included in the block.

Re: Elon Musk accidentally created a new cryptocurrency. WTF?
by
Swapzone_pr
on 11/11/2021, 13:45:05 UTC


The founder of Tesla and SpaceX, Elon Musk, again stirred up the cryptocurrency market on Friday, leaving a seemingly harmless message about his new dog.

He said that he chose a nickname for his Shiba Inu puppy. His name will be Floki. In early May, Elon Musk first announced that he intends to take a Shiba Inu puppy. Then the cost of the Shiba Inu cryptocurrency increased by 68% in an hour.

After Friday's announcement by Musk, the Shiba Inu exchange rate increased by 26%, but later corrected. However, another thing is more interesting: 9 minutes after the appearance of Musk's post on Twitter, the Floki token was created on the decentralized Uniswap crypto exchange. Within an hour, its price increased by 795%, to $0.000000001100. As a result, the growth was about 3500%.

Success for crypto will be bitcoin losing its crown to a stablecoin?
by
Swapzone_pr
on 11/11/2021, 12:52:44 UTC
The founder of the Avalanche network, Emin Sirer, claims that the “reasonable” value of stablecoins will give them an edge over other cryptocurrencies. He believes that we will not complete the formation of the crypto market until stablecoin becomes the number one coin, that is, the first sign of the massive success of cryptocurrencies will be the fact that any stablecoin will overtake Bitcoin and become the leading digital currency.

It's understandable cause apart from being able to stabilize price volatility, stablecoins are also supported by multiple sources of assets. It could be a traditional currency like the US dollar, commodity, precious metals, or algorithmic functions, or other cryptocurrencies.

However, the risk level for stablecoins is greatly influenced by its backing, so isn't that a "too much" claim?
